As the Senate continued debate on President Obama’s fast-track trade authority request, Majority Leader Mitch McConnell (R-KY) said during leader time that the vote later that day would be about whether to have a debate on trade bills, and he urged senators not to filibuster or delay the process. Minority Leader Harry Reid (D-NV) asked that the bills be put together and brought to the Senate floor with an amendment process. close
